Bio
For more than 15 years, Michael Catino, M.D., has specialized in orthopedic spine surgery. He is board-certified by the American Board of Orthopaedic Surgery, and received his medical degree from the University of Pittsburgh. After completing his general surgery internship and orthopedic residency at the University of Pittsburgh Medical Center in Pittsburgh, Pa., Catino finished his fellowship at Maryland Spine Fellowship in Towson, M.D., where he trained with world-renowned surgeon Dr. Paul McAfee. He has co-authored numerous research papers, and is one of the Dallas/Fort Worth area’s foremost experts on orthopedic spine surgery.
Catino specializes in spine surgery, with an emphasis on complex revision spine surgery. He has a special interest in treating injuries and conditions related to the cervical spine. He takes a conservative approach to spinal care — pursuing non-surgical treatment options prior to considering surgery. When surgery is necessary, he employs minimally-invasive techniques whenever possible.
Catino joined physical medicine and rehabilitation specialist Dr. Jennifer Zahn at Texas Health Presbyterian Hospital Denton to form the Neck and Back Center, prior to practicing privately and co-founding North Texas Neck and Back.
In his earlier years, Catino played college football on a full scholarship. As a defensive player, he learned the importance of staying physically fit. He continues to stay physically active and participates in various endurance events.
